UCPD is searching for the suspects in a hate crime and unlawful discharge of a BB gun on campus Sunday. The suspects were reportedly in a vehicle and allegedly approached a victim and struck the victim with a BB gun early Sunday morning, according to a UCPD crime alert sent Monday afternoon. This post was updated Oct. 29 at 8:37 p.m. Los Angeles County ended cash bail for many low-level and nonviolent crimes Oct. 1. The decision – enacted by the LA Superior Court – created a new pre-trial arraignment protocol that allows individuals to remain in their communities before appearing in court, said Ysabel Jurado, a community lawyer and candidate for LA City Council District 14.
